(This note is not part of the Regulations)
These Regulations amend the Highlands and Islands Rural Enterprise Programme Regulations 1991.
The Regulations in particular:—
(a)extend the definition of “eligible person” to enable applications to be received from members of the immediate family of the occupier of the agricultural unit (regulation 3(b) and (c));
(b)provide for notice to be published of areas selected for the operation of the scheme (regulation 4);
(c)allow a period of 21 days for representations to be made against a decision to revoke approval of an application or to recover financial assistance paid (regulation 8(c));
(d)extend the diversification measures for which assistance may be given (regulations 3(a) and 9);
(e)make certain other minor and drafting amendments (regulations 3(d), 5, 6, 7, 8(a) and (b)).
